Collaboration Agreement to Empower Saudi Arabia’s Local Talent with Advanced Science and Technology Skills

Dell Technologies, Aramco, and the National IT Academy (NITA) have joined forces in a groundbreaking collaboration aimed at enhancing Saudi Arabia’s local talent in the fields of science and technology. This strategic partnership focuses on equipping Saudi students with advanced training programs and certifications to cultivate a skilled and readily employable technology workforce within the Kingdom.

The agreement, signed by key representatives from Aramco, NITA, and Dell Technologies, outlines a four-month program called ‘ITXcelerate’. This program is designed to provide recent Saudi graduates in computer engineering, computer science, and IT with Dell Proven Professional Certification in areas such as storage management, data science, and AI. Additionally, participants will benefit from hands-on experience, job shadowing, and mentorship opportunities to enhance their practical skills and knowledge.
